[Ireland and its fellow members released the statement above.  The Human Security Network, a cross-regional group of states that advocates a people-centred, holistic approach to security, welcomed the annual report of the Secretary-General as well as the adoption of a Presidential Statement on Children and Armed Conflict, and expressed its appreciation to Leila Zerrougui, SRGG for Children and Armed Conflict.  The press statement, issued by current HSN Chair, the Permanent Representative of Chile to the United Nations, calls for future Council debates on this important topic to be open to every Member State to participate.]

EU Statements at the UN

All Member States of the European Union work together with the Council of the EU and the European Commission to prepare and finalise EU statements, The Member State holding the Presidency presents the EU position to the United Nations General Assembly in the form of a Presidency Statement. With the 27-Member Union speaking in this way with a single voice, on many occasions individual Member States of the Union decide not to take the floor additionally to deliver a national statement. Please click here for the list of EU Presidency statements.
